Wisconsin Non-Hispanic American Indian and Alaska Native Alone Citizen Population By County in 2013 (ACS-5Yrs)

Updated on March 28, 2026.

Based on the US Census Bureau's special tabulation from the ACS 5-year estimates, in 2013, the Non-Hispanic American Indian & Alaska Native Alone citizen population for Wisconsin was 23,045 and represented 0.42% of the total Wisconsin citizen population.

Among all Wisconsin counties, Brown had the highest Non-Hispanic American Indian & Alaska Native Alone citizen population (5.55K), followed by Milwaukee (4.01K), and Menominee (3.41K).

In terms of percentages, Menominee had the highest percentage of its citizen population being Non-Hispanic American Indian & Alaska Native Alone (81.46%), followed by Sawyer (16.68%), and Forest (13.46%).
